Description of Programs

1. In school programs to teach students K-12 the basic concepts of business and economics and how education is relevant to the workplace and introduce them to many economic concepts and useful facts about the working world.
2. Organizes “Career Days” where volunteers visit schools to talk about their careers
3. Junior Achievement Company Program- 12 week night program where students run their own company
4. Job Shadow/ Field Trips- Takes Middle and High School students into the workplace to learn about career
5. Junior Achievement is also a resource to after school programs, providing curriculums and materials to teach kids about personal economics and business.
